Madness in Hamlet
A look at the theme of madness in Shakespeare's "Hamlet".
2,900 words (approx. 11.6 pages) | 11 sources | 2002 United States


Paper Summary:

This paper discusses the play Hamlet. The focus is upon whether or not Hamlet's madness is feigned or real. The opinions of the characters as to Hamlet's madness are considered, as are his own words and actions. The paper concludes with the observation that the truth concerning Hamlet's madness cannot be conclusively determined because Shakespeare himself is vague as to whether it is genuine or not.
